Citi has raised its price target on Micron Technology (NASDAQ:MU) to $840 from $425, maintaining a Buy rating, following expectations of a 40% rise in DRAM prices in calendar Q2. The firm also anticipates further increases in HBM pricing next year due to constrained capacity and disciplined supply management. The update comes amid strong trading activity for MU in 2026.

(NASDAQ:MU) to $840 from $425, keeping a Buy rating. The firm cited expectations that the company is raising DRAM prices by 40% in the calendar second quarter. This follows competitor Samsung’s reported 100% price increase in the previous quarter. Citi projects the DRAM recovery to continue through calendar year 2027. Looking ahead, the firm anticipates that HBM (High Bandwidth Memory) pricing could move even higher next year. The outlook is based on constrained HBM capacity and an assumption that memory manufacturers will remain disciplined in adding new supply. Such discipline, according to Citi, would help prevent a reduction in HBM content in AI data centers during 2027. On the same day, Melius Research also elevated its view on Micron, though specific details from that report were not available in the source. Micron (NASDAQ:MU) has been among the most actively traded U.S. stocks so far in 2026. The key takeaway from Citi’s updated stance is the accelerating momentum in the memory chip market, particularly for DRAM and HBM. The 40% expected price increase in DRAM during Q2 suggests robust demand conditions, possibly driven by data center expansion and AI-related workloads. Samsung’s earlier 100% price rise may have set a precedent that Micron is now following. The focus on disciplined supply additions indicates that memory makers are aiming to avoid overcapacity, which has historically led to price declines. Citi’s view that HBM pricing could rise further next year reflects a tight supply-demand balance for high-bandwidth memory used in AI accelerators. This development may support Micron’s revenue and margin trajectory over the medium term. Additionally, the fact that multiple research firms are turning more positive on Micron signals a potentially broader consensus about the memory cycle’s strength. Investors may interpret these actions as validation of the company’s strategic positioning in advanced memory products. The price target increase and Buy rating reflect Citi’s expectations, but actual outcomes depend on numerous factors including demand sustainability, competitive dynamics, and macroeconomic conditions. The memory industry has historically experienced cyclical swings, and the current upcycle may not persist indefinitely. The projected DRAM price rises and HBM pricing trajectory could support Micron’s financial performance, but any slowdown in AI spending or a sudden increase in supply from competitors might alter the landscape. The assumption of continued discipline among memory makers is a key variable; deviations from this could pressure prices.
